‘Thieving’ Lupane man on the run after striking neighbours with an axe, iron bar

A Lupane man is on the run after he struck a father and his son with an axe and iron bar after they confronted him for stealing their blankets and water buckets.

The accused, identified by police as Nkosilamandla Ncube from Dakiwe Village under Chief Mabhikwa allegedly struck with an axe Msongelwa Msimanga (56) on the head before attacking his son Walter Msimanga (32) with an iron bar twice on the head after they confronted him for stealing their property

He has been charged with attempted murder.

Police said on Monday at around 6pm, Walter arrived at his homestead from Plumtree and discovered that his twenty liter buckets, five blankets, one amplifier and a 650 watts solar battery were missing.

He then observed some shoe prints within his yard and went to inform his father, who is a neighborhood security officials and a manhunt was launched.

“On 22/11/22 at around 8pm, Walter Msimanga and Msongelwa Msimanga went to the accused person’s homestead and managed to locate him,” police said in a statement.

“Msongelwa then requested to search the accused person’s room and he was given the green light.

“During the search at around 8pm, the two found one of their three missing buckets and the accused immediately took an axe and stroke Msongelwa thrice on the head and he fell down before hitting Walter twice with an iron bar on the head and he managed to bolt out of the room to seek help.”

However, when some villagers came to the scene, the accused had already left his homestead, but they managed to assist the father who was lying on the ground profusely bleeding.

“Msongelwa sustained deep cuts on the head and a cut on his left ear and condition is critical,” police said.

“He is currently admitted at Saint Luke’s hospital and Walter sustained two deep cuts on the head and his condition is stable.”
